<h3>What is a Metro District in Colorado?</h3>
Metropolitan districts are known to be a kind of a quasi-governmental bodies that has taxing authority that are known to be used to handle or finance the needed public infrastructure and services that a City are not able to otherwise provide.
Note that the metro district is said to be a kind of a type of special district that was gotten from Colorado's Special District Act and it is one that is made up of about 1,819 metro districts
